Drag Illustrated and Jerry Bickel Race Cars have launched a groundbreaking incentive program for Pro Modified drag racing, introducing the JBRC No. 1 Qualifier Bonus and the Jerry Bickel Clean Sweep Challenge for the 2025-26 Drag Illustrated Winter Series. Designated as the official qualifying partner, JBRC will award $5,000 to the No. 1 qualifier at the Snowbird Outlaw Nationals, $7,500 at the U.S. Street Nationals, and $10,000 at the World Series of Pro Mod, totaling $22,500 in bonuses.

The standout feature is the Clean Sweep Challenge: if a driver secures the No. 1 qualifier position at all three events, they will win a brand-new Jerry Bickel Race Cars Pro Mod rolling chassis valued at over $200,000. Wes Buck, Founder & Editorial Director of Drag Illustrated, highlighted the unprecedented cash incentives and the motivation they provide for racers.

Rick Hord, owner of Jerry Bickel Race Cars, voiced his enthusiasm for the increased interest in Pro Mod racing and emphasized the initiative’s aim to support competitors who fuel their business.

The series, which includes the Snowbird Outlaw Nationals (December 4-7, 2025), the U.S. Street Nationals (January 22-25, 2026), and the World Series of Pro Mod (February 26-28, 2026), is expected to draw over 90 entrants, making the JBRC program one of the sport’s most valuable qualifying incentives.
